  • Regulatory Summits

    This summit provides updates on regulatory affairs that are crucial to conducting business in China. PCHi has invited representatives from various governing bodies such as China’s Ministry of Health, Guangdong Food & Drug Administration, China Cosmetics Quality Assurance Committee, International Cosmetics (Asia Pacific) Joint Development Centre, and Guangdong Cosmetics Standards & Testing Center to speak on regulatory issues concerning the cosmetics industry.

  • Formulators' Workshop

    The workshop aims to provide industry professionals with an understanding of the many aspects of formulation and technical know-how. There will be a total of three sessions, each lasting two hours. Seats for the workshops are limited to ensure that participants have adequate attention from technical experts.

    Besides onsite workshops, PCHi is working with association partners and media to conduct a workshops seminar for formulators in June. This will be held in Guangzhou.
